diff options
author | Steffen Klassert <steffen.klassert@secunet.com> | 2012-11-13 08:52:24 +0100 |
---|---|---|
committer | Steffen Klassert <steffen.klassert@secunet.com> | 2012-11-13 09:15:07 +0100 |
commit | 703fb94ec58e0e8769380c2877a8a34aeb5b6c97 (patch) | |
tree | 57bb3948dfe46f9dcd36b92ec4112408c7d5cc73 /include | |
parent | a66fe1653f4e81c007a68ca975067432a42df05b (diff) | |
download | linux-stable-703fb94ec58e0e8769380c2877a8a34aeb5b6c97.tar.gz linux-stable-703fb94ec58e0e8769380c2877a8a34aeb5b6c97.tar.bz2 linux-stable-703fb94ec58e0e8769380c2877a8a34aeb5b6c97.zip |
xfrm: Fix the gc threshold value for ipv4
The xfrm gc threshold value depends on ip_rt_max_size. This
value was set to INT_MAX with the routing cache removal patch,
so we start doing garbage collecting when we have INT_MAX/2
IPsec routes cached. Fix this by going back to the static
threshold of 1024 routes.
Signed-off-by: Steffen Klassert <steffen.klassert@secunet.com>
Diffstat (limited to 'include')
-rw-r--r-- | include/net/xfrm.h |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/include/net/xfrm.h b/include/net/xfrm.h index 6f0ba01afe73..63445ede48bb 100644 --- a/include/net/xfrm.h +++ b/include/net/xfrm.h @@ -1351,7 +1351,7 @@ struct xfrm6_tunnel { }; extern void xfrm_init(void); -extern void xfrm4_init(int rt_hash_size); +extern void xfrm4_init(void); extern int xfrm_state_init(struct net *net); extern void xfrm_state_fini(struct net *net); extern void xfrm4_state_init(void); |